    Precarious Ties: Business and the State in Authoritarian Asia
    • 2023

      Examining the dynamics between political and business elites reveals critical insights into the political-economic paths of authoritarian regimes, particularly in developing Asia. Meg Rithmire presents a fresh perspective on these relationships, highlighting their evolution and impact on regime stability. She introduces two conceptual models to elucidate the variation and instability in state-business interactions, offering a deeper understanding of the complexities inherent in authoritarian governance and capitalist growth.

      Land Bargains and Chinese Capitalism

      • 238 pages
      • 9 hours of reading

      Focusing on the origins of Chinese land politics, the book delves into the complexities of property rights and the varying urban growth strategies employed across different cities in China. It highlights how these factors influence urban development and governance, providing insights into the unique political and economic landscape of the country.
